Exciting work you will do:
  • Use Program and Project Management expertise to lead delivery across complex engagements, maximize delivery impact, transform the client's thinking, and influence their decision making.
  • Lead several technical project workstreams at a program level.
  • Own all aspects of delivery and client relationship building; focus on delivery excellence and creating lasting change for clients.
  • Dive deep into the challenges facing clients and think big to develop creative solutions to their toughest problems.
  • Develop trusted relationships with client executive teams and industry organizations that result in new business opportunities.
  • Contribute to the future of the firm by leading internal initiatives to build its capability and expertise in Program and Project Management.
  • Develop the firm's long-term sales strategy to position and market its expertise with current and target accounts.
  • Be known as a recognized thought leader in Program and Project Management.

What you will need:
  • 10+ years' experience managing projects in one or more of the following: enterprise software applications (JavaScript frameworks), cloud (data lakes, hybrid, migrations, etc), Business Intelligence (predictive analytics, data visualization), ERP systems.
  • 6+ years of management consulting, advisory, professional services, industry and/or Big 4 consulting experience.
  • Proven subject matter or content expertise in Project and Program Management of multiple technical workstreams.
  • Experience with Waterfall and Agile ways of working (including SAFe or Scrum@Scale).
  • Experience running engagements, managing teams, and driving desired business outcomes throughout delivery, as well as the ability to pinpoint gaps and omissions.
  • Creative ingenuity and a proven ability to find or design simple solutions to complex challenges.
  • An ability to authentically establish credibility, build consensus, and activate collaboration with clients and teammates.
  • Excellent interpersonal communication skills.
  • PMP certification is a plus.
  • Scrum Master, SAFe, Scrum@Scale certification is a plus.
  • Experience in Software Engineering is a plus.
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college/university. A master's degree in a related field is a plus.
